Pallet Stacking AGVs are commonly used in scenarios such as pallet transportation and production line docking, as well as storage in line-side warehouses. They are suitable for narrow-aisle rack storage and narrow-aisle production line handling, and can be deployed in industries like new energy, automotive parts, 3C electronics, and tobacco.
Technical Highlights:
CE Certification.
With a rated load capacity of up to 2 tons and a width of only 930mm, these AGVs feature a minimum turning radius of just 1250mm, enabling smooth operation in narrow aisles. A maximum lifting height of 3300mm is achievable, and customizations are available to suit different carriers.
Equipped with a floating drive system that automatically adjusts traction force based on the load, ensuring stable and effortless passage over ramps and uneven surfaces.
Standard with a pallet recognition camera and a pallet positioning pressure plate, enabling handling of various pallets, racks, and containers. Capable of precise pickup even with deviations of up to ±10° or ±10cm.
Multi-layered safety protection includes 360° obstacle avoidance laser scanners, fork-tip diffuse reflection photoelectric sensors + mechanical obstacle avoidance for safe load pickup, and a 3D plane detection camera to ensure safety in human-robot interaction scenarios.
Narrow-Aisle Three-Way Stacking AGV Forklift utilizes 180° fork rotation and lateral shifting to handle stacking and loading/unloading on both sides of the aisle. Without requiring the vehicle to turn, the forks can efficiently pick up and place goods, enabling simpler and safer operations while significantly improving productivity. It is designed for medium-to-high level narrow-aisle stacking applications.
Technical Highlights:
Servo-driven three-way fork head ensures safe, reliable, and smooth operation.
Imported Curtis and servo controllers provide enhanced stability, safety, and precision.
High-strength imported mast with ample strength reserve ensures stable and safe performance.
Full-wheel braking system offers steady operation even at elevated heights.
Customizable designs available to accommodate various pallet types and aisle dimensions.

The Cold-Storage Reach AGV is commonly used in indoor high-rack, narrow-aisle warehouse freezing environments. It is capable of continuous operation in temperatures ranging from 0°C to -18°C and can also perform alternating cycles in freezing conditions from -20°C to -30°C.
Technical Highlights:
Compact body structure design that easily meets intensive stacking requirements in cold storage environments.
Equipped with side-mounted wireless charging for higher charging reliability.
Specialized cold-storage navigation heads and obstacle avoidance sensors with high reliability.
Cold storage-specific oils and greases ensure efficient and safe transmission systems in cold storage.
Cold storage-specific anti-corrosion and rust-proof paint, chains, and cylinders easily cope with the humid environment of cold storage.

This multidirectional reach truck AGV features a mast that can move entirely forward or retract, with independently controlled four-wheel steering. It supports multiple movement modes including straight-line travel, lateral movement, diagonal travel, and in-place rotation. During lateral movement, it requires only minimal aisle width, making it particularly suitable for handling long loads.
